should fit. though if your unsure, measure the trackwidth from outside to outside of one axel's wheels. touring cars come in 190 and 200mm varieties. also, measure the wheelbase. locknut to locknut center. anything from 258-262mm is average. otherwise, you would just paint the hpi body, ream the holes where the body mounts and cut out the wheel arches. i find it easier to cut out the clear body first and place it over the car, ream the holes for mounting position, then paint and cut out arches.
mount the body with the car ready to run so it sits at natural ride height.
